The ultimate ham and cheese sliders - a hot ham and cheese sandwich that melts in your mouth. These make such an easy dinner, and they're great to feed a crowd for game day!
Slice buns in half and line a 9x11 baking dish with the bottom half of the buns.
Spread mayonnaise bottom buns.
Top with ham and cheese (don't worry about overlap of cheese.) Put bun tops on.
In a small bowl, combine butter, worcestershire sauce, minced onion, and poppy seeds. Cover sandwiches with sauce, reserving ¼ cup.
Cover with aluminum foil or lid and bake 12 minutes. Remove foil or lid, return to over for an additional 2 minutes or until cheese is melted.
Pour remaining sauce over sandwiches and serve warm.

Notes
Substitutions
Cocktail Buns - Small dollar rolls, cocktail buns, egg buns, Hawaiian rolls.
Mayonnaise - Use whatever mayonnaise you have on hand, however miracle whip is not a suitable substitute.
Ham - Can substitute with sliced chicken, turkey or roast beef.
Swiss Cheese - Can substitute with cheddar, Monterey jack, provolone or mozzarella.
Butter - Salted or unsalted.
Minced Onion - Substitute fresh white or yellow onion.
Tips
Slice buns while still connected to make it quick and easy.
How to Store
Refrigerate - Up to 3 days stored in an airtight container.
Freeze - Bring to room temperature and store up to 3 months in an airtight container.
Reheat
Microwave - Reheat one minute uncovered in the microwave, turn and reheat one additional minute. Add melted butter to refresh sauce, if needed.
Oven - Preheat oven to 350°F and bake covered 15-20 minutes until cheese is melted. Refresh sauce with melted butter if needed.
